After some deliberation with SWMBO I agreed to replace the bog standard Drayton RTS1 analogue room stat with a digital one. I chose a Honeywell DT90E. So I removed the faceplate on the Drayton stat, and found it's a 3 wire (plus earth) installation - Live, Neutral and Call. Looking at the Drayton wiring diagram it's a switched live between Live and Call. Makes sense.

The wiring diagram for the Honeywell shows only one 3 wire installation, the rest being 2 wire.  If I follow the 3-wire diagram will it work which wires should I connect where? The Live is obviously connected to terminal A.  Do I need to connect the Neutral at all, and if so will it be to C?, or do I tape it up and just connect the Call to terminal B?

Looking at the diagrams on the web relating to DT90 (your link is to a file on your PC) it is switched live.  So connect live to terminal A and call to terminal B. Option A from teh diagram



DO NOT CONNECT NEUTRAL TO TERMINAL C

If you connect Neutral to terminal C you will short live and neutral together when the heating is not being called.  This would potentially destroy your new thermostat as a minimum or cause a fire in your house worse case.
